Babarboh - Amla, Betul
Babarboh is a village situated in the Amla tehsil of Betul district, Madhya Pradesh. It is located approximately 20 km from the tehsil headquarters in Amla and around 50 km from the district headquarters in Betul. Babarboh village is a designated Gram Panchayat.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Babarboh is 486474. The village covers a total geographical area of 956.85 hectares and falls under the 460661 pincode. Multai is the nearest town, located about 20 km away.
Babarboh village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head.
Population of Babarboh
As per Census 2011, Babarboh village has a total population of 1,456 people, consisting of 749 males and 707 females. The village has 295 households and a sex ratio of 943 females per 1,000 males. There are 171 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 916 literate and 540 illiterate residents. Additionally, 275 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ities and 82 to Scheduled Tribe (ST) communities.

Transport and Connectivity of Babarboh
Babarboh is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through bus services. The nearest railway station is Barchi Road, while the nearest airport is Dr. Babasaheb Ambedkar International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 93.2 km.
